Building healthy soil with understanding, using locally available organic matter, is essential to boosting our vegetable beds into sustainable and steady production. In order to make this happen, some community participants volunteer to help layer our compost and then ‘flipping’ it over once weekly until the pile reaches 160 degrees.
Putting healthy food on the table during tough economic times has caused folks everywhere to take a closer look at saving money and considering what they can produce for themselves. But besides the economic advantage, when you grow your own food, you have security in knowing where your food comes from and who has handled it.
